Related Product Information for anti-CXCL10 antibody
Description: Rabbit IgG polyclonal antibody for C-X-C motif chemokine 10(CXCL10) detection. Tested with WB, IHC-P in Human.
Background: C-X-C motif chemokine 10(CXCL10), also known as Interferon gamma-induced protein 10 kDa(IP-10) or small-inducible cytokine B10, is a protein that in humans is encoded by the CXCL10 gene. It is a small cytokine belonging to the CXC chemokine family. The gene for CXCL10 is located on human chromosome 4 in a cluster among several other CXC chemokines. Luster et al.(1987) reported the isolation of an interferon-inducible gene that encodes a 98-amino acid protein called IP10. The chemokine IFN-gamma-inducible protein 10(IP-10; CXCL10), a CXC chemokine, and its receptor, CXCR3, were found to be overexpressed in lymph node cells of EAMG rats. IP10 inhibits bone marrow colony formation, has antitumor activity in vivo, is a chemoattractant for human monocytes and T cells, and promotes T cell adhesion to endothelial cells.

NCBI Description

This antimicrobial gene encodes a chemokine of the CXC subfamily and ligand for the receptor CXCR3. Binding of this protein to CXCR3 results in pleiotropic effects, including stimulation of monocytes, natural killer and T-cell migration, and modulation of adhesion molecule expression. Uniprot Description

CXCL10: Chemotactic for monocytes and T-lymphocytes. Binds to CXCR3. Belongs to the intercrine alpha (chemokine CxC) family.

Protein type: Secreted; Secreted, signal peptide; Motility/polarity/chemotaxis; Chemokine

Chromosomal Location of Human Ortholog: 4q21
